How often do you practice?
Practice is 5 days a week (Monday-Friday) until the first league game, then practices will drop to 3 days a week (Tuesday-Thursday)
Where do we practice?
Practices are held at Mesa Verde High School located at 7501 Carriage Dr., Citrus Heights, CA 95621

Are board members or coaches screened or trained?
Coaches are required to complete background checks, mandated reporter training, heads up training, and our football coaches take an additional AB1 training.
Board members are required to complete background checks and mandated reporter training.

What's included in football registration?
- Practice Jersey
- Mavericks In Training Clinic
- Use of all necessary equipment (helmet, shoulder pads, etc.)
- Game Day Fields
- Practice Fields
- Emergency response onsite at all games
- Game Day Officials
- Insurance for practice and game day facilities
- End of season banquet, awards, & trophies
What's not included in football registration?
- Tethered mouthpiece
- Practice pants
- Cleats
Plus: $70 football uniform (includes 2 game jerseys, 1 pair of game pants, & 1 pair of socks)
*To ensure inclusion of an athlete’s name on their football jersey, registration must be completed by June 1.
